I'm really hurt to see CJ go just because I thought he was the quintessential Raven who clearly wanted to be here. With that being said though, secure the bag. I wouldn't pass up $17M a year either, especially when reports had the Ravens at around $14M. I was on board with the team signing him around that amount, but I'm glad DeCosta and company made the tough call to move on. $17M is just ridiculous money.

I do wonder if they regret not franchising him. Of course, hindsight is 20/20, but CJ probably would have signed for $14-14.5M/year if the negotiations were limited just to the Ravens. Kwon set the market so it would have given us a price. No one but CJ was getting $17M.

At this point, just focus on our current guys and build for next year. Let the young guys play and see what you have. I don't see the point in investing in a whole bunch of veteran stop gaps. Unless you want to make a splash and get Bell, keep the big money in house so another CJ situation doesn't happen.
